Ticket: Staging env misconfigured for Siftgate bloom filter

The bloom layer in front of the Pellet KV store is rejecting all lookups in staging because the env file was copied from the dev template without credentials. False-positive tuning values are fine; only the auth line is missing. To unblock the weekly demo, the Pellet admission secret must be set on the following line.

env line for yaguf-fajop: LEDGER_TOKEN13=fb08984397349

## Break-Glass Access — Pickwise Optimizer

If the warehouse pick-list optimizer at Farrowgate goes unresponsive and normal admin login fails, support may use the emergency account. Use only during a declared incident, and log it in the incident channel afterward. The emergency console prompts for a recovery passphrase, which is:

vault phrase of kawep-tahog = ulaix-briath

## v2.8.0 — Canary gating update

Heads up, plugin folks: Glimmerhost now blocks canary promotion if your plugin's error rate climbs above 0.5% during the bake window. No more sneaking past with a quick retry loop — the gate checks rolling averages. Update your manifests to declare health endpoints before the next release train. Questions about gating rules go to our canary lead.

account owner for yahog-kafop: Istius Rusix

**Ticket: Firmware update channel serves stale manifest — Heathwick Devices**

Devices on the beta channel of the Corvelle updater pull a manifest cached from the previous rollout. Root cause: channel key isn't included in the cache lookup, so beta and stable collide. Fix adds the channel to the cache key and invalidates on publish. Reviewer: check the invalidation path for the rollback case too — a rolled-back publish must also purge. Repro steps attached. The failing build's trace token is below.

trace token, tawep-fahif: htk3_b58

Handover note — Crumbwheel order cutoffs.

Welcome aboard. The bakery cutoff rule in Crumbwheel closes same-day orders at 14:00 local to each storefront, not UTC — this has bitten us twice. Holiday overrides live in the calendar service and take precedence silently, so always check there first when a cutoff looks wrong. To unlock the calendar service's admin console after a restart, enter the recovery passphrase below.

vault phrase of bagap-bahaf = silion-pelox-sorox-casdor-quenwyn-fraax-eliox-praael-kelion-quenvan-kasox-rusael-norius-belvan